Good Tunes, Bad Messages
Blackout is a good CD. It has catchy tunes, but the messages are all about the same things over and over, how hot and sexy Britney is. For parents, "Get Naked (I Got A Plan)" really is as bad as it gets. The other songs are somewhat suggestive but I think "Get Naked" tops it all. If you want some catchy tunes, buy Blackout, if you're concerned about the suggestiveness of the CD, don't buy it. Really know your kid before you buy it or just listen to it.

Britney's back and better than ever
It's been about ten years since Britney Spears' debut in the music scene with ...Baby One More Time. But the days of the slightly suggestive schoolgirl are over, and her music is no longer appropriate for the younger crowd. This album is very sexually explicit, and there's also one use of "motherf*cker" and references to alcohol. Britney's latest is great, but not appropriate for anyone under 12.
